1.APPLICANT: HAWAIIAN RIVERBEND, LLC (REZ 12-157)
Applications for a State Land Use Boundary Amendment from Agricultural to Urban and
a Change of Zone from Agricultural 5-acres (A-5a) to Village Commercial-20,000 square
feet (CV-20) for approximately 14.622 acres of land. The property is located on the
northeastern intersection of Waikoloa Road and Paniolo Avenue, makai of the Waikoloa
Stables and east of the Waikoloa Village Highlands Shopping Center, Waikoloa, South
Kohala, Hawai‘i, TMK: 6-8-002: por 021.

4.APPLICANT: INNOVATIONS PUBLIC CHARTER SCHOOL (Amend SPP 1262)
Amendment of Special Permit No. 1262, which allowed the establishment of a public
charter school and accessory facilities for up to 200 students between grades 1 and 6, on
5 acres of land situated within the State Land Use Agricultural District. The amendment
is to allow the expansion of the school by increasing enrollment to a maximum of 350
students, expand the grades of instruction to kindergarten through 12, and increase the
campus size to 9.298 acres. The subject property is located along the east (mauka) side
of Queen Ka‘ahumanu Highway, approximately 1,500 feet north of the Queen
rd
Ka‘ahumanu Highway – Hualalāi Road intersection, Pua‘a 3, North Kona, Hawai‘i,
TMK: 7-5-010:001.

5.APPLICANT: COUNTY OF HAWAI‘I D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C WORKS
(SMA 12-051)
Application for a Special Management Area (SMA) Use Permit for the extension of
La‘aloa Avenue as a two-lane, 60-foot wide collector roadway for approximately
1,900 feet to connect with Kuakini Highway (Alternative Alignment 3, Cross Section
Alternative B), La‘aloa 1 and 2 and Pāhoehoe, North Kona, Hawai‘i, TMK: 7-7-004: 068,
7-7-008: 029, 114, 120 and 7-7-28: 007.
